Understanding Misted Windows
Misting takes place when moisture develops between the panes of double or triple glazing. This generally indicates that the window system has actually lost its seal, permitting air and humidity to go into the area between the Glass Condensation Repair. Here's a better look at some typical causes of misty windows:
Common CausesAge: Over time, the seals on double-glazed windows can break down, enabling moisture to enter.Temperature level changes: Rapid modifications in temperature level can trigger sealing products to contract and broaden, leading to prospective failure.Poor setup: Improper setup can lead to sealing failures and increased opportunities of condensation.Humidity levels: High indoor humidity, especially in badly aerated areas, can worsen misting issues.Repair Options for Misted Windows
When confronted with misted windows, property owners have a number of repair alternatives at their disposal. Each option varies in terms of cost and effectiveness. Below is an overview of the main repair approaches:
1. DIY Repair
For those aiming to save cash, DIY repair may be a feasible choice. Here's how:
Drill Method: Tools Needed: Drill, little drill bit, and a hairdryer.Utilizing a little drill bit, create tiny holes at the bottom of the misted window. This allows moisture to leave.Utilize a hairdryer to clear any staying moisture.Finally, seal the holes with a clear silicone sealant.
Please note that this method is not permanent and may lead to additional concerns down the line.
2. Foggy Window Repair Defogging Services
Professional window defogging services can get rid of condensation without requiring to replace the whole window unit. Professionals use specific equipment to safely eliminate moisture and restore clarity.
3. Seal Replacement
If the window is still in great condition but the seal has Failed Double Glazing, replacing the seal is an alternative. Experts can get rid of the old seal, clean the glass, and install a new, durable seal.
4. Complete Window Replacement
In cases where the window is extensively harmed or the frames are degraded, a complete window replacement might be required. This choice tends to be the most costly but makes sure that the issue is totally dealt with.
